u/gooblefrump 17h ago

But the bigger problem, the company said, was that the repair plan laid out in the contract called for the layers of liner to include two chemicals that turned out to be incompatible.

The chemical on top reached a temperature hotter than what the compound underneath could withstand, and the heat caused the bottom layer to blister and come loose, the documents show. The contractor said it had not expected that outcome because it was very uncommon to mix the two products in that way.
